How much does it cost to rent a home in Sandy?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sandy 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,553 | $1,190 | $2,495 |
| Sandy 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,600 | $1,400 | $5,995 |
| Sandy 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,035 | $2,190 | $5,649 |
| Sandy 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,391 | $750 | $5,950 |
| Sandy 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,492 | $3,200 | $7,500 |
| Sandy 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,100 | $5,100 | $5,100 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Sandy
What type of rentals are currently available in Sandy?
There are currently 200 Apartments for Rent in Sandy, UT with pricing that ranges from $700 to $14,767. There are also 162 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Sandy ranging from $700 to $7,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Sandy?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Sandy ranges from $700 to $7,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,808.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Sandy?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Sandy range from $1,349 to $6,019,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,400 to $5,995.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,190 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,899.
